Council Meeting: September 25, 2001 Santa Monica, California
TO: Mayor and City Council
FROM: City Staff
SUBJECT: Recommendation to Adopt a Resolution Authorizing the City Manager to
Accept a State Grant Award and Enter into a Grant Agreement for a
CCAP (Career Criminal Apprehension Program) State-of-the-Art Project
Introduction
This report recommends that the City Council adopt the attached resolution authorizing
the City Manager to accept a $98,119 grant award and enter into a grant agreement
with the State of California, Governor?s Office of Criminal Justice Planning (OCJP).
Funds from this grant will be used to purchase software that aids Police Department
efforts to identify and apprehend career criminals.
Discussion
On July 24, 2001, Council authorized acceptance of this grant award that will be used to
purchase CrimeView mapping software and to develop a software interface between the
Police Department?s Automated Mobile Field Reporting System and the FileNet
document library. OCJP also requires adoption of a resolution authorizing the City
Manager to enter into a related grant agreement with the State of California.
Financial/Budget Impact
No additional financial or budget impact will result from the adoption of this Council
resolution. Revenue and capital improvement project accounts (#20304.406570 and
#C20068602.589000, respectively) were established in the amount of $98,119 for these
grant funds.
